Kathleen Walls This is the only gallery of its kind in the world telling the marine stories of the Civil War. The centerpiece is an area of CSS Jackson, the largest surviving Confederate ironclad. The CSS Chattahoochee, a gunboat constructed to shield Columbus, which was a large manufacturing center for army devices and attires, gets on display.

Kathleen Walls USA Today elected The National Infantry Museum # 1 Best Free Museum. The museum focuses on infantry as the very first line of defense from the American Change to desert warfare. There's a primary gallery and a different one for each war. From the back window, you can see a little WWII town.

Kathleen Walls The 150-year-old Springer Opera Residence is Georgia's State Movie theater. It was as soon as thought about the finest theater between Washington and New Orleans.


Edwin Cubicle played Hamlet. It is still showing the very best of the very best. Employees state Booth's ghost and numerous others roam the backstage location. Kathleen Walls It thrilled me to do a backstage scenic tour. There is a hotel on the upper floors for entertainers. The dressing room location is filled with art and genuine furnishings, and Emily Woodruff Hall has posters from previous efficiencies lining its wall surfaces. Columbus.


In the days of segregation, this was where "colored" customers sat. The seats are bare timber seats yet, as our guide explained, it's the most effective view in your house. Chattachooche River (Picture Debt: Kathleen Walls) Nevertheless the land fun, it's time to go whitewater rafting on the Chattahoochee River. Its two-and-a-half-mile run is the longest urban whitewater rafting worldwide. You can pick The Timeless or The Obstacle run. Because the river has actually water launched from the dam daily, there are various river speeds.


Columbus Weather Things To Know Before You Buy


In the afternoon, when the dam is opened, the rapids relocate much faster. Since this was my initial time, I picked the slower run.


He offered us quick instructions. The rapids have names: Ambush is complied with by Jaws, after that a tranquil stretch called Lazy River. The last rapids are Cut Bait. I assumed we were going to turn there, more information yet we survived and paddled to a landing on the RiverWalk. It's 2 to 3 hours of interesting enjoyable, however not for the faint of heart or those scared of water.
